Hasegawa 65554 kit overview for mecha modellers

The Hasegawa 65554 presents the RVR-77-B Affirmed-T Type B in 1/100 scale and is aimed at collectors and builders who favour anime-style mecha. This release captures key design elements from the Virtual-On Marz setting while supporting customised finishes.

Styling and surface detail

Parts are moulded with clear panel lines and authentic proportions, giving builders a solid base for panel lining and weathering. The kit is suited to those who like to add fine paintwork and decals for a display-quality result.

Building approach and tips

Assembly follows a snap-fit format that is forgiving for newcomers yet still rewarding for experienced modellers. While the parts come in base colours for quick builds, careful painting and seam cleanup will raise the overall finish.

Specifications

  • Scale: 1/100
  • Color Separation: Parts are molded in base colors; painting is optional.
  • Assembly Type: Snap-fit
